High cholesterol levels can trigger chronic diseases. Therefore it needs to be kept within normal limits. One of them is by drinking regularly tea.

Each person’s blood cholesterol levels are different. It can be influenced by gender, body weight and age. Checking blood cholesterol is important. Ideally every 4-6 months.

As is known, for adults, total cholesterol levels of less than 200 milligrams per deciliter (mg/dL) are in the normal category. Meanwhile, bad LDL cholesterol must be less than 100 mg/dL.

Potions Tea to Lower Cholesterol Levels

Many studies have been conducted to prove the health benefits of tea. This includes consuming tea which functions to control cholesterol in the body and helps reduce bad cholesterol.

As quoted from NDTV, here are 3 types of tea from the camellia sinensis tea plant that you can drink regularly. These three types of tea are easy to find in supermarkets or tea shops.

1. Green tea

Green tea is known to be good for overall health. Green tea is loaded with antioxidants and other health benefits. Able to lower cholesterol levels and reduce the risk of heart disease.

You are advised to consume two cups of green tea a day. Drinking a cup of green tea will also help you lose weight.

2. Oolong tea

The next tea ingredient for lowering cholesterol levels is oolong tea. Oolong tea is also known to be very good for heart health.

A cup of oolong tea can help reduce the risk of increasing bad cholesterol levels in the body.

Apart from that, oolong tea also helps in managing blood sugar levels so that it can reduce the risk of diabetes and heart disease.

3. Black tea

Black tea can also lower cholesterol levels. This fermented tea full of powerful tannins is rich in antioxidants that can help reduce cholesterol levels.

Regularly drinking black tea without sugar is also effective for controlling blood sugar levels, controlling blood pressure, and improving intestinal health.
